+ /// Get the number of visible frames. Frames may be created if \p can_create
+ /// is true. Synthetic (inline) frames expanded from the concrete frame #0
+ /// (aka invisible frames) are not included in this count.
uint32_t GetNumFrames(bool can_create = true);
+ /// Get the frame at index \p idx. Invisible frames cannot be indexed.
lldb::StackFrameSP GetFrameAtIndex(uint32_t idx);
+ /// Get the first concrete frame with index greater than or equal to \p idx.
+ /// Unlike \ref GetFrameAtIndex, this cannot return a synthetic frame.
lldb::StackFrameSP GetFrameWithConcreteFrameIndex(uint32_t unwind_idx);
+ /// Retrieve the stack frame with the given ID \p stack_id.
lldb::StackFrameSP GetFrameWithStackID(const StackID &stack_id);
- // Mark a stack frame as the current frame
+ /// Mark a stack frame as the currently selected frame and return its index.
uint32_t SetSelectedFrame(lldb_private::StackFrame *frame);
+ /// Get the currently selected frame index.
uint32_t GetSelectedFrameIndex() const;
- // Mark a stack frame as the current frame using the frame index
+ /// Mark a stack frame as the currently selected frame using the frame index
+ /// \p idx. Like \ref GetFrameAtIndex, invisible frames cannot be selected.
bool SetSelectedFrameByIndex(uint32_t idx);
+ /// If the current inline depth (i.e the number of invisible frames) is valid,
+ /// subtract it from \p idx. Otherwise simply return \p idx.
uint32_t GetVisibleStackFrameIndex(uint32_t idx) {
if (m_current_inlined_depth < UINT32_MAX)
return idx - m_current_inlined_depth;
@@ -55,16 +62,23 @@ public:
return idx;
}
+ /// Calculate and set the current inline depth. This may be used to update
+ /// the StackFrameList's set of inline frames when execution stops, e.g when
+ /// a breakpoint is hit.
void CalculateCurrentInlinedDepth();
+ /// If the currently selected frame comes from the currently selected thread,
+ /// point the default file and line of the thread's target to the location
+ /// specified by the frame.
void SetDefaultFileAndLineToSelectedFrame();
+ /// Clear the cache of frames.
void Clear();
- void InvalidateFrames(uint32_t start_idx);
-
void Dump(Stream *s);
+ /// If \p stack_frame_ptr is contained in this StackFrameList, return its
+ /// wrapping shared pointer.
lldb::StackFrameSP
GetStackFrameSPForStackFramePtr(StackFrame *stack_frame_ptr);

+ /// The thread this frame list describes.
Thread &m_thread;
+
+ /// The old stack frame list.
+ // TODO: The old stack frame list is used to fill in missing frame info
+ // heuristically when it's otherwise unavailable (say, because the unwinder
+ // fails). We should have stronger checks to make sure that this is a valid
+ // source of information.
lldb::StackFrameListSP m_prev_frames_sp;
+
+ /// A mutex for this frame list.
+ // TODO: This mutex may not always be held when required. In particular, uses
+ // of the StackFrameList APIs in lldb_private::Thread look suspect. Consider
+ // passing around a lock_guard reference to enforce proper locking.
mutable std::recursive_mutex m_mutex;
+
+ /// A cache of frames. This may need to be updated when the program counter
+ /// changes.
collection m_frames;
+
+ /// The currently selected frame.
uint32_t m_selected_frame_idx;
+
+ /// The number of concrete frames fetched while filling the frame list. This
+ /// is only used when synthetic frames are enabled.
uint32_t m_concrete_frames_fetched;
+
+ /// The number of synthetic function activations (invisible frames) expanded
+ /// from the concrete frame #0 activation.
+ // TODO: Use an optional instead of UINT32_MAX to denote invalid values.
uint32_t m_current_inlined_depth;
+
+ /// The program counter value at the currently selected synthetic activation.
+ /// This is only valid if m_current_inlined_depth is valid.
+ // TODO: Use an optional instead of UINT32_MAX to denote invalid values.
lldb::addr_t m_current_inlined_pc;
- bool m_show_inlined_frames;
+
+ /// Whether or not to show synthetic (inline) frames. Immutable.
+ const bool m_show_inlined_frames;
